Css 如何为自定义属性添加显示:无
我已为输入添加了一个自定义属性。如何为该自定义属性添加Css 如何为自定义属性添加显示:无,css,Css,我已为输入添加了一个自定义属性。如何为该自定义属性添加display:none?因为这不是类或id <input type="text" myAttr="cusAttr"> 您可以尝试CSS属性选择器 CSS[attribute=“value”]选择器 [attribute=“value”]选择器用于选择具有指定属性和值的元素 试试这个: input[myAttr="cusAttr"]{ display:none; } 它叫 为此 <section myAttr="
display:none
?因为这不是类或id
<input type="text" myAttr="cusAttr">
您可以尝试CSS属性选择器 CSS[attribute=“value”]选择器 [attribute=“value”]选择器用于选择具有指定属性和值的元素 试试这个:
input[myAttr="cusAttr"]{
display:none;
}
它叫
为此
<section myAttr="cusAttr"></section>
在输入的情况下
<input type="text" myAttr="cusAttr">
这将选择具有属性myAttr和值cusAttr的所有元素
但是如果你想更具体的话
input[myAttr~="cusAttr"]{
display : none;
}
及
是否更具体添加此css:input[myAttr=“cusAttr”]{display:none;}可能的重复项在发布此问题之前您是否尝试过在谷歌上搜索它?如果没有,你能看看这个URL吗?如果我这样给出
解决方案是什么section[myAttr=“cusAttr”]{display:none;}
是否正确?只需将input
替换为section
。如果不正确,您可以简单地尝试此选择器:[myAttr*=“cusAttr”]
。这将隐藏具有myAttr
属性值且包含cusAttr
的所有元素。我可以使用吗?不能像这样使用。不能使用[myAttr~=“cusAttr”]
是的,可以使用具有此属性的任何psedo类
[myAttr="cusAttr"]{
display:none;
}
input[myAttr~="cusAttr"]{
display : none;
}
section[myAttr="cusAttr"]{
display:none;
}